Terry Lester criticized the amount of story and airtime LLB was having as Cricket in at least one published interview.  He felt the show was giving her too much, and Jack had been sidelined.  This was 1989, and the truth is she was on too much and had too much story at that time IMO.  With Nina and Danny and her mom, she was tied to almost every story on the show, in her own stories and multiple crossover stories.

And I don’t hate Christine.  But it was too much.
